Access Cuyahoga County Court Records

Need to look up information about court proceedings in Cuyahoga County? You can efficiently view the court docket online. The Cuyahoga County Court website makes available a searchable portal of court documents. To launch your search, you'll need the court identifier or the names involved in the matter.

Once you have this information, you can enter it into the online search tool. The system will then show all relevant records associated with that legal proceeding.

Navigating Cuyahoga County Public Records

Cuyahoga County's public record system presents a wealth of information to the general public. This transparency allows citizens to scrutinize various aspects of county functions, including financial records, property listings, court documents, and more. To effectively harness this valuable resource, it's essential to grasp the different types of records available and the processes involved in accessing them.

  • Popularly sought public records in Cuyahoga County include:

  • Land ownership documents
  • Budget reports
  • Court case files

The method for requesting public records in Cuyahoga County is generally easy. Typically, you will submit a written request to the appropriate department or office. Remember to provide clear and specific information about the records you seek.

Obtain Cuyahoga County Court Documents Online

Need to access court documents related to a case in Cuyahoga County? You're in luck! The clerk's office offers an online platform that allows you to explore records electronically. This user-friendly tool can save you time and effort compared to visiting the courthouse in person. To get started, you'll need to navigate to the official website for Cuyahoga County Court Records. Once there, you can input case information such as parties and court dates. The system will then present a list of relevant documents that are available for examination.

Keep in mind that some documents may be sealed due to privacy concerns or other legal reasons.
